When Coca-Cola Was Liquid C0caine | Boring History For Sleep
Before it became the world’s most iconic soft drink, Coca-Cola was something far more intense a bubbling tonic packed with actual coca leaf extract. In this quietly told episode of Boring History for Sleep, we gently uncover the real history of Coca-Cola’s drug-fueled beginnings, when it was marketed as a miracle medicine and sipped by the elite… and the addicted.
